Student director outlines mixed-use condo plan with green features

Lawndale City Student Council · May 13, 2026

The student director of community development described a proposal for a mixed-use condominium on Hawthorne Boulevard and Manhattan Beach with ground-floor commercial space, upper-level residences, underground parking, green walls and green roofs for community gardening.

The student director of community development told the council the city is considering a mixed-use condominium at Hawthorne Boulevard and Manhattan Beach that would combine ground-floor commercial space with upper-level residences.

The director described plans for underground parking and environmentally focused features including a green wall and green roofs that would provide space for community gardening.

The presentation was informational: the director outlined design goals and environmental elements but did not present a finalized application, specific parcel address, developer name, timeline, or request a council vote during the meeting.

Next steps were not specified in the transcript; any formal land-use decisions or entitlement hearings would require separate staff reports and council action.
